Characteristics And Motives Of The Christian Life: Ten Sermons is a book written by William John Knox Little, originally published in 1894. The book consists of ten sermons that explore the defining traits and motivations of a Christian life. Little draws from biblical teachings and personal experiences to offer insights into the nature of faith, love, and service to others.The sermons cover a range of topics, including the importance of prayer, the role of forgiveness in Christian life, and the need for humility in serving others. Little also addresses the challenges that Christians face in their daily lives, including temptation, doubt, and fear.Throughout the book, Little emphasizes the importance of living a life that is guided by faith and motivated by love. He encourages readers to develop a deeper understanding of God's love and to use that love as a driving force in their relationships with others.Overall, Characteristics And Motives Of The Christian Life: Ten Sermons is a thought-provoking and inspiring exploration of the principles and values that define a Christian life.
